About Haote Han

Haote Han is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Ophthalmology, Epidemiology,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and Oncology, having authored 36 papers that have together received 320 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Autophagy in Disease and Therapy (8 papers), Ocular Oncology and Treatments (6 papers), Retinal Diseases and Treatments (5 papers), Retinal and Macular Surgery (5 papers), Neuroscience and Neural Engineering (4 papers), Natural product bioactivities and synthesis (4 papers), Retinal Development and Disorders (4 papers) and Cancer-related Molecular Pathways (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Ophthalmology (56 citations), Toxicology (12 citations), Molecular Biology (206 citations), Biochemistry (15 citations) and Cancer Research (29 citations). Haote Han has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Jingkui Tian, Wei Zhu, Hetian Lei, Shouxin Li, Na Chen, Ruyi Li, Xionggao Huang, Bingxian Yang, Jiangyun Liu and Jing Cui. Their work appears in journals such as Biosensors and Bioelectronics, Experimental Eye Research, Journal of Proteomics, Laboratory Investigation and Scientific Reports.
